ELK GROVE, Calif., May 19, 2009 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- ALLDATA(r), the leading
provider of manufacturers' service and repair information, shop management
software and customer relations tools for the automotive repair and collision
industries, has added additional 2008 vehicles to its do-it-yourself auto repair
product. As part of its recent update of ALLDATAdiy.com for vehicle owners,
ALLDATA has added original equipment manufacturer (OEM) information covering a
wide range of 2008 makes, including, but not limited to manufacturers such as
Ford(r), General Motors(r) and Honda(r).
"ALLDATAdiy.com is a powerful tool for both do-it-yourselfers, as well as for
vehicle owners looking for information prior to taking their vehicle to
professionals," says Paul Marshall, Program Manager for ALLDATAdiy.com. "It
provides vehicle-specific information from the manufacturer including
procedures, recalls, technical service bulletins, and repair-specific labor
times. The information in ALLDATAdiy.com is complete - never edited or
summarized."
ALLDATAdiy.com provides vehicle owners with access to the most complete
collection of OEM information for most vehicles sold in the United States from
1982 through 2008.
Updated regularly, the information contained in ALLDATAdiy.com is accessible
from any computer with Internet access. Each vehicle-specific subscription
includes the latest factory recalls, technical service bulletins (TSBs),
diagnostic trouble code information, factory part numbers and labor times and
thousands of detailed diagrams.

About AutoZone's ALLDATA
ALLDATA, founded in 1986, with more than 70,000 repair shops as subscribers, is
the leading provider of manufacturers' service and repair information, shop
management software and customer relations tools for the automotive repair and
collision industries. Professional automotive repair shops across North America
depend on ALLDATA for their automotive repair information needs, and to purchase
parts from more than 2,200 AutoZone Commercial program locations.

About AutoZone:
As of February 14, 2009, AutoZone sells auto and light truck parts, chemicals
and accessories through 4,141 AutoZone stores in 48 states, the District of
Columbia and Puerto Rico in the U.S. and 158 stores in Mexico. AutoZone is the
leading retailer and a leading distributor of automotive replacement parts and
accessories in the United States. Each store carries an extensive product line
for cars, sport utility vehicles, vans and light trucks, including new and
remanufactured automotive hard parts, maintenance items, accessories, and
non-automotive products. Many stores also have a commercial sales program that
provides commercial credit and prompt delivery of parts and other products to
local, regional and national repair garages, dealers, and service stations.
AutoZone also sells the ALLDATA brand diagnostic and repair software. On the
web, AutoZone sells diagnostic and repair information, and auto and light truck
parts through www.autozone.com. AutoZone does not derive revenue from automotive
repair or installation.
